Cameron Terrell is a white, wealthy teen that made headlines in 2017, when he was charged in the murder of Justin Holmes, a 21 year-old black man from South Central, Los Angeles.

  • I was actually next-door neighbors with Cameron growing up I lived right by his home on Navajo drive shown in the video. Completely normal kid, and role model parents, they all seemed like great people. It is beyond fathomable to me that someone that showed as much intelligence and common sense as Cameron would spend even one second thinking about stepping into this world. Something must have been wrong from the beginning of course, but seeing such success and happiness for years just to learn of this story broke my heart. The parents ended up selling the home they themselves built and moved away just to distance themselves from what happened, so sad.
